Altice USA reported a 5.8% YoY increase in total revenue, reaching $2.57 billion in Q3 2021. Net income attributable to stockholders was $266.9 million, a significant improvement compared to the net loss in Q3 2020. The company is focusing on broadband customer growth and investing in its Residential business.
Total revenue grew by 5.8% YoY, driven by growth in Residential, Business Services, and News & Advertising segments.
Net income attributable to stockholders was $266.9 million, compared to a net loss of $4.7 million in the same quarter last year.
Adjusted EBITDA increased by 3.4% YoY to $1.16 billion with a margin of 45.2%.
Residential broadband net losses were -13k in Q3 2021, compared to +26k broadband net additions in Q3 2020.
Altice USA updated its financial outlook for FY 2021, expecting revenue growth, adjusted EBITDA growth, cash capital expenditures of ~$1.3 billion, free cash flow of ~$1.6 billion, and share repurchases of < $1.0 billion.
